You wan outshine God?” – Comic Actor Bishop ‘Okon’ Umeh warns men against trying to satisfy women (video)

Nigerian comic actor Okon has sparked an online conversation with a viral TikTok video, where he warns men not to lose themselves trying to please women, comparing the act to trying to outdo God Himself.

In the clip, Okon draws a controversial parallel using the 48 Laws of Power, saying:

“One of the 48 laws of power is that you should not try to outshine your master.”

He went on to list several beauty practices women engage in, suggesting that their constant changes reflect a level of dissatisfaction that men shouldn’t try to keep up with:

“If the hair is coily, they stretch it. If it’s straight, they curl it.
If it’s black, they dye it white. If it’s white, they dye it black — sometimes pink.
Eyebrows? Natural o, they shave am, draw another one.
Eyelashes? Fix on top the one wey God give them.
Thin lips? Surgery. Big breast? Reduction.
Small breast? Implant. No nyash? Implant. Big nyash? Reduction.
Black skin? Bleaching cream. Fair skin? Sun tanning.”

He ended the video with:

“If God wey create them never satisfy them, how much more you, ordinary person? You wan out do God? You dey try outshine your master? You dey set yourself up for destruction.”
